Equinor ASA ADR
ENERGY · OIL & GAS INTEGRATED · USA
Equinor ASA, an energy company, is engaged in the exploration, production, transportation, refining and marketing of petroleum and petroleum products and other forms of energy, as well as other companies in Norway and internationally. The company is headquartered in Stavanger, Norway.
Fox Corp Class B
COMMUNICATION SERVICES · ENTERTAINMENT · USA
Fox Corporation is an American mass media company headquartered in New York City.
